LEAD-FREE SOLDER 

WARNING:

 

This product is manufactured using lead-free solder as a part of a movement within the consumer products industry at 

large to be environmentally responsible. 

Lead-free solder must be used in the servicing and repair of this product. 

The melting temperature of lead-free solder is higher than that of leaded solder by 86ºF to 104ºF (30ºC to 40ºC). Use of a soldering 
iron designed for lead-based solders to repair product made with lead-free solder may result in damage to the component and or 
PCB being soldered. Great care should be made to ensure high-quality soldering when servicing this product especially when 
soldering large components, through-hole pins, and on PCBs as the level of heat required to melt lead-free solder is high.

Safety Precaution 

WARNING:

 

Servicing should not be attempted by anyone unfamiliar with the necessary precautions on this receiver.  The following 

are the necessary precautions to be observed before servicing this chassis. 

1. 

An isolation transformer should be connected in the power line between the receiver and the AC line before any service is 
performed on the receiver. 

2. 

Always disconnect the power plug before any disassembling of the product. It may result in electrical shock. 

3. 

When replacing a chassis in the cabinet, always be certain that all the protective devices are put back in place, such as 
nonmetallic control knobs, insulating covers, shields, isolation resistor-capacitor network, etc. 

4. 

Always keep tools, product components, etc. away from children as these items may cause injury. 

5. 

Depending on the model, use an isolation transformer or wear suitable gloves when servicing with the power on.  
Disconnect the power plug to avoid electrical shock when replacing parts.  In some cases, alternating current is also 
impressed in the chassis, so electrical shock is possible if the chassis is contacted with the power on. 

6. 

Always use the replacement parts specified for the particular model when making repairs. The parts used in products 
require special safety characteristics such as inflammability; voltage resistance, etc. therefore, use only replacement parts
